Output fda4535442675949cbc08f8faadc0a13d0beed7f3cb571081c85d325304a5372:0

value
515627
script pubkey
OP_0 OP_PUSHBYTES_20 8cf42d54b1e431471c423342235207cf9fda583f
address
bc1q3n6z6493usc5w8zzxdpzx5s8e70a5kplxpt32r
transaction
fda4535442675949cbc08f8faadc0a13d0beed7f3cb571081c85d325304a5372
spent
true